Paver Flooring Installation in Longmont, CO
Paver flooring installation involves placing durable, decorative paving materials to enhance outdoor and indoor spaces. This service is commonly used for driveways, walkways, patios, and garden pathways, providing a functional and attractive surface that can withstand heavy foot traffic and weather conditions. Property owners typically want to understand the types of pavers available, such as concrete, brick, or stone, as well as the design options and maintenance requirements to ensure the finished project complements their property’s aesthetic.
Before requesting paver installation, homeowners often seek information about the scope of the project, including surface preparation, the installation process, and expected durability. It’s important to consider the existing terrain, drainage needs, and any local building codes that may influence the design and materials chosen. Clear communication about project goals and preferences can help ensure the finished surface meets both practical needs and visual expectations.

Paver Flooring Installation Questions
What types of paver flooring are available for installation? Common options include concrete, brick, and natural stone pavers, each offering different aesthetics and durability for various outdoor spaces.
What projects typically use paver flooring? Paver flooring is often used for pat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or seating areas to enhance appearance and withstand weather conditions.
How should property owners prepare for paver installation? Clear the area of debris, ensure proper drainage, and discuss desired patterns and materials with the installer for a smooth process.
What maintenance is needed for paver flooring? Regular sweeping and occasional washing help maintain appearance, while resealing may be recommended to preserve color and prevent staining.
